1. A system for activity monitoring, comprising:

  • at least one infrared-emitting tag;

    an infrared monitoring device configured to capture an infrared image of an environment that comprises at least one patient being monitored and the at least one infrared-emitting tag;

    an image analysis module, comprising a processor and a memory, configured to determine a relationship between the patient being monitored and the at least one infrared-emitting tag; and

    an activity module configured to determine an activity conducted by the patient being monitored based on the relationship between the patient being monitored and each infrared-emitting tag wherein each infrared-emitting tag emits infrared radiation in a unique spatial pattern;

    wherein the unique spatial pattern is emitted by a plurality of resistive paths laid out in a pattern on each of a respective infrared-emitting tag by passing a current through the plurality of resistive paths to generate heat and infrared light; and

    an alert module configured to adjust a course of treatment for the patient being monitored based on the determined activity.
